Oh.. I forgot to point out that this cylinder head is from Cylinder Heads International (CHI). I couldn't find any good reviews of the company and only a couple bad reviews so I'll be posting about my results when I come to a conclusion. Right now the head is setting at AMS in Fort Collins being checked over by skilled automotive machinist before I install it.
So far the shipping was quick, the head looks great, still has the penetrating dye on the valves and dome. The head has been resurfaced, looks like it got a cam grind, should have new valve shaft seals and a 3 angle valve job.
My only complaint right now is the paint.. they painted the head and covered the intake and exhaust gasket surface and got some over spray onto the cam seal land. this is a pretty minor complaint and will easily be corrected with some brake cleaner and a towel.
